Frequently Asked Questions about Wilmington
How much are Studio apartments in Wilmington?
There are currently 38 Studio Apartments in Wilmington with rent ranges from $825 to $3,734 with an average price of $1,374.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Wilmington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Wilmington ranges from $825 to $4,842 with an average monthly rent of $1,621.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Wilmington c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Wilmington range from $915 to $8,115.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,939.
How expensive are Wilmington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 132 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Wilmington on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$715 to $8,568 - averaging $2,342 for the location.
